Camping

Experience the awe-inspiring stark wilderness of Lake Eyre National Park at night by setting up camp.

Camp sites are available at Halligan Bay where toilets and a picnic shelter is provided, or at the privately owned Muloorina Station which includes toilet facilities. When camping at Muloorina Station please pay a camping fee at the honesty box ($2 from each nightly fee is donated to the Royal Flying Doctors Service).

Campgrounds with toilet and shower facilities are also located at Marree, William Creek, and at Coward Springs, 130 km west of Marree on the Oodnadatta Track.

Important information for campers:

  • Wood fires are not permitted in the park. Please use liquid fuel or gas stoves only
  • All fires (including liquid and gas) are prohibited in the park on Total Fire Ban Days
